Rugby League. Framed 1963-64 'The Eleventh Australian Rugby League Touring Team' large original photo of the 1963-64 Kangaroos in suit & hat. The first all Australian team to win the Ashes in England, plus another 1963-64 squad framed photo (copy) in their playing kit. This squad includes some of the greatest players to play the game inc John Raper, Graham Langlands, Ken Thornett, Reg Gasnier, Arthur Summons, Ken Irvine, Noel Kelly etc. Also 1962 Country team original photo featuring Graham Langlands who was part of the team that defeated City 18-8. Overall dimensions between 380x330mm & 670x590mm. All GC. (3).SOLD at A$100

1915-16 Australian patriotic embroidered hanging. White open-weave cloth 670mm x 440mm. Geometrical edge designs with central design of upright kangaroo, 2x interpretations of Gallantry Crosses (1x presumably the VC) & the wording. 'ANZAC - FOR VALOR - BRAVO AUSTRALIA'. All designs in coloured cross-stitch embroidery. An intriguing patriotic piece, possibly a young lady's sampler or trial piece. Minor stains. VGC. SOLD at A$250
